Are people in Bayonne older or younger than people in Edgewater?- The Median Age in Bayonne is 1.9 years older than in Edgewater.
Are housing costs cheaper in Bayonne or Edgewater?- Bayonne
housing costs are 21.6% less expensive than Edgewater hous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Bayonne or Edgewater?- The average commute for residents of Bayonne is 6.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Edgewater.

Things to do in Bayonne?Bayonne, New Jersey is an incredible city located just across the Hudson River from Manhattan. This vibrant city offers plenty for visitors to explore such as the historic Military Ocean Terminal or the captivating Stephen R. Gregg Park. Residents here also take advantage of all the outdoor activities available at Richard A. Rutkowski Park, 16th Street Park, and Bayonne Golf Club.
